Compact Wide Band Microstrip Line Feed Microstrip Patch Antenna for Wireless Application

Abstract

This paper presents the increase in bandwidth of a Microstrip Antenna using a simple slotted structure fed by Microstrip line. The main aim of proposed work is to obtain a large bandwidth antenna with reduced size. The proposed microstrip antenna has a wide bandwidth covering the range from 1.806-2.978 GHz. By using simple Microstrip Line feed wide bandwidth of 48.99% has been achieved. The proposed patch antenna is designed and simulated on the Zeeland IE3D software.
